The Rise of Free-to-Play Slots: An Industry Overview
The traditional gambling model has long depended upon direct monetary engagement—players deposit real money to spin reels, place bets, or participate in games of chance. However, the advent of the free-to-play paradigm introduced a nuanced approach, allowing users to access immersive gaming experiences without initial financial commitment. This approach has expanded the industry’s reach significantly.
According to recent data from the International Gaming Regulatory Commission (IGRC), approximately 60% of new online slot titles released in 2023 incorporate free-to-play features, signifying a shift towards responsible gaming and community-building. This aligns with a broader trend towards player engagement metrics that prioritize retention and brand loyalty rather than immediate revenue generation.
The Strategic Benefits of Free-to-Play in Digital Slots
| Benefit | Description | Industry Example |
|---|---|---|
| Player Acquisition | Lower entry barrier attracts a wider audience, including casual players, who may later convert to paying customers. | Ganing popularity in Asian markets, titles like Horus slot demonstrate an effective free-to-play onboarding process. |
| Brand Visibility | Offering F2P versions enhances brand recognition, providing promotional avenues for monetised features. | Game developers leverage free demos to build community interest, often linking to lucrative paid versions. |
| Player Retention & Engagement | F2P models facilitate gameplay without pressure, promoting longer-term involvement and player loyalty. | Deeply immersive themes like Egyptian mythology, as seen in Horus slot, captivate users, increasing session times. |
| Data-Driven Optimization | Free versions serve as testing grounds for gameplay mechanics, user interface improvements, and monetisation strategies. | Analytics from Horus slot demonstrate best practices in balancing free features with monetised enhancements. |
